Meanings of Prop
Verb
-
To support something so it doesn't fall over.
-
To play in a special position in rugby called prop.
-
To lift someone's legs up while they are sitting or lying down.
Noun
-
An object that helps to hold something up or support it.
-
A player in a rugby game who helps the team by pushing in the scrum.
-
A special item used in games or plays to make them more fun.
Explanation of the word: Prop
A prop is an object that actors use in a play or movie. It helps make the story more real. For example, a sword in a pirate play is a prop!
